Joint Venture Proposal — Managers Only

Heads-up, branch managers: we're in talks with Ostermere Logistics about a joint venture to run shared depots across the northern region. Think pooled fleets, one booking system, split margins. Nothing is signed yet, so keep it off the floor. Terms and timelines are still moving. The confidential business-plan note sits just below for context.

internal memo for kawip-hadug: Headcount on the Wenwyn team goes from 7 to 140 by the end of January. Gross margin on Wenwyn came in at 20 percent against a plan of 15 percent.

Handover for the Orchestra Hall seat-map renderer: plugin hooks for pricing overlays and accessibility badges are stable as of this release. Zoom-level callbacks fire twice on touch devices — known issue, fix planned. Plugins should read canvas dimensions from the context object, not the DOM. The renderer initializes with the configuration below.

service settings:
PRAIX_LOG_LEVEL=error
PRAIX_METRICS_HOST=metrics.praix.qorvelcorp.corp
PRAIX_POOL_SIZE=16

Alert: RateParityDrift — fires when the Lodgemark parity checker finds a tracked property whose public rate on a partner channel undercuts our direct rate by more than 2% for two consecutive scan cycles. Scans run every 20 minutes against the Fennick comparison feed. The alert payload includes property slug, channel, delta, and scan timestamps. Reviewers: note the dedupe window is 6 hours, so repeat deltas won't re-fire. False positives usually trace to stale cache entries in Fennick. Questions about threshold tuning go here.

billing contact of tahaf-kafop = istwyn_fraox@norvaworks.corp

## Local Setup — Ledgerpine Invoice Renderer

Clone the repo, install dependencies with the pinned toolchain file, and run the font-cache script once so PDF output matches production glyph metrics. The renderer reads invoice rows and merchant branding from the billing schema, so you will need a local database. Configure your environment to connect using the connection string below.

primary connection of tajeg-tajop = postgresql://julax_svc:DI@db-e7f3.kelvidyn.corp:5432/rusdor